A Brief History

The word “casino” itself conjures images of luxury and opulence, but the origins of these establishments are humble. The word “casino” comes from the Italian language, meaning “little house.” Early casinos were often attached to hotels, offering entertainment to guests through games of chance.

The modern concept of the casino as we know it today began to take shape in the 17th century, with the opening of the Ridotto in Venice, Italy, in 1638. This was one of the world’s first known casinos, offering controlled gambling during carnival season. Over time, casinos spread across Europe and eventually to the United States, where they flourished in cities like Las Vegas and Atlantic City.

The Psychology of Gambling

Casinos are expertly designed to captivate and entice visitors, employing various psychological tactics to keep them engaged and spending money. From the layout of the gaming floor to the colors used in decor, every aspect of a casino is carefully curated to create a specific atmosphere.

Slot machines, for example, are strategically placed near entrances and exits to attract attention and encourage people to play. The sounds of winning, the flashing lights, and the promise of a big jackpot all contribute to the allure of these games. Meanwhile, table games like blackjack and roulette offer a more social experience, allowing players to interact with each other and the dealer.

Controversies and Criticisms

Despite their popularity, casinos have faced their fair share of controversies and criticisms. One of the most common concerns is the potential for gambling addiction. For some individuals, the thrill of gambling can spiral out of control, leading to financial ruin and personal hardship.

Casinos have also been accused of exploiting vulnerable populations and contributing to social inequality. Critics argue that these establishments often target low-income communities, taking advantage of people who can least afford to lose money.

Additionally, there are ethical concerns surrounding the industry, particularly regarding issues like money laundering and organized crime. While many casinos operate within the bounds of the law, there have been instances of illegal activities taking place within these establishments.
